Output 6a03c324fdea7ff1fcbbce9b1aa23e223d420aac6f45adeae6f19c7808ffcd4e:28

value
9986467
script pubkey
OP_0 OP_PUSHBYTES_20 686138a023930b0e043d9dc029206a0246ef2df7
address
bc1qdpsn3gprjv9suppanhqzjgr2qfrw7t0hlzwq8q
transaction
6a03c324fdea7ff1fcbbce9b1aa23e223d420aac6f45adeae6f19c7808ffcd4e
spent
true